Changing a single disc (SINGLE CHANGE)

a single disc (SINGLE CHANGE)

By main unit only

While one disc is playing, you can change the discs in other
trays.

1

Press [

0, SINGLE CHANGE].

2

Press [

3, 1] ~ [3, 5] to select the desired tray.

3

Change the disc.

4

Press [

0, SINGLE CHANGE] again to close the tray.

Note:

• When track number 25 or greater is playing, remaining play time

display shows “– –:– –”.

• When a title is longer than 9 characters, it will scroll across the

display. The scrolling will start after every 3 seconds.

• “NO TAG” is displayed if titles with tags have not been entered.
• Maximum number of displayable characters: approximately 32
• This unit can display album, track and artist name with MP3 ID3

tags (version 1.0 and 1.1).

• Titles containing text data that the unit does not support cannot

be displayed.

• ID3 is a tag embedded in MP3 track to provide information about

the track.

• Titles entered with 2-byte code cannot be displayed correctly on

this unit.

Note:

• You cannot program CD-DA together with MP3 tracks.

• The program memory is cleared when you change a disc or open

the disc tray.

• You cannot program more than one disc.
